Bill Information

Regular Session 1985-1986
House Bill 2645


Short Title:
An Act amending Title 18 (Crimes and Offenses) of the Pennsylvania Consolidated Statutes, defining the offenses of graffiti mischief and the unlawful sale of spray paint or indelible marker; and providing penalties.
Prime Sponsor:
Last Action:
Referred to JUDICIARY, June 18, 1986 [House]
